Top 5 Energy Storage news

 

1. 357MW of storage have been awarded in Belgium’s latest capacity market auction.

2. Energy Vault Holdings announced a 1.16 GWh projects plan in China.

3. Quinbrook Infrastructure Partners has signed a global framework agreement with CAT for over 10 GWh of energy storage solutions.

4. Pacific Green has secured a £123.5 million (US$153 million) facility to support its 1.5-hour, 249MW/373.5MWh battery energy storage system (BESS) in Kent, UK.

5. Georgia Power has announced through its integrated resource plan (IRP) an additional 4GW of renewables and up to 1GW of battery storage resources target.

 

+1 Hydrogen news

1. RWE will receive EUR 4.7 million (USD 5m) in funding from the state of North Rhine-Westphalia to install a 5-MW electrolyser.
